The definitive account of the rise and fall of the world's fastest plane from British Airways' former Chief Concorde Pilot.

October 24th, 2023 will mark 20 years since Concorde disappeared from our skies. Yet still Mike Bannister, the last Concorde Chief Pilot, faces the same questions:

  • Why is she no longer flying?
  • Where is her replacement?
  • And what really happened on that tragic afternoon in July 2000, when the crash of Flight 4590 grounded the Concorde forever?

Concorde is an enthralling personal account of what it takes to fly planes faster than the speed of sound, and of the events that lay behind 114 needless deaths—the 113 victims of the crash and, ultimately, Concorde herself.
